Sperm DNA damage:an independent parameter for evaluation of sperm quality

NI Wu-hu

Open publisher page 0 citations

Abstract

Objective:To analyze the relationship between sperm DNA damage assessed by sperm chromatin dispersion(SCD) and parameters of routine semen analysis.Methods:1098 cases of male infertility were examined by routine semen analysis and SCD for detection of sperm DNA fragmentation as expressed DNA fragmentation index(DFI).The relationship between DFI and sperm concentration,motility,and morphology were analyzed.Results:4.9% case with normal param-eters of routine semen analysis had DFI 30% and 72.3% cases with at least one abnormal parameter had DFI 30%.There were significant differences of age,abstinence duration,total amount of sperm,total amount of mobile sperm,D grade sperm,normal morphology,head defect,neck defect,and tail defect among the three groups classified as DFI20%,20~30% and ≥30%.The correlative analysis showed DFI was moderate or weak positive correlation to age,abstinence duration,D grade sperm,head defect,neck defect,and tail defect(r=0.118,0.109,0.572,0.217,0.311 and.278,respectively),but negative corre-lation to total amount of sperm,total amount of mobile sperm,and normal morphology(r =-0.224,-0.345 and-0.303,respectively).The stepwise linear regression showed age,abstinence duration,D grade sperm and neck defect were independent variables related to DFI.Conclusion:Sperm DNA damage has moderate or weak correlation to parameters of routine semen analysis.In some cases of male infertility,sperm DNA damage may be an independent parameter to evaluate sperm quality.
